Average Cost of Solar Panels in Reliez Valley
Let's have a look at the average cost of solar in Reliez Valley.
Currently, the national average cost of solar panels is $2.66 per watt. However, in Reliez Valley, the average cost of solar panels is 2.73 per watt. To cover the typical energy needs of the average home in Reliez Valley, most homeowners require a 3.0-kilowatt system. Using the per-watt figure above, a solar installation costs around $5,809, or $8,307 before the federal solar tax credit of 30% is applied.
Keep in mind that the numbers above are only averages. The price you'll end up paying for solar may look quite different based on your household energy consumption, the type of solar panels you choose, your solar contractor and more. Many homeowners find adopting solar power is a solid investment. The average homeowner in Reliez Valley can save around $33,000 on their power bills over 20 years.

Factors that Affect Solar Panel Costs in Reliez Valley
The cost of installing a solar system in Reliez Valley can vary by more than $10,000 from home to home. Your actual cost is determined by several factors. The most significant one is your system size, and other factors include the equipment you choose, financing options and the solar company you choose.
Solar Equipment
The size of the solar panel system you need, which is measured in kilowatts, is the most important cost factor to consider. For every additional kilowatt you need, your total will most likely increase by about $2,730. The kind of solar panels and equipment you want is another factor that will greatly impact costs. Solar panels that are more efficient, like monocrystalline panels, tend to cost more. Further, solar equipment is more than just the solar panels themselves. You'll also need to make decisions about the kind of racks used to mount the panels, inverters, solar batteries, etc. It's important to take all of this into consideration when researching a solar system that's in your budget.
Solar Financing Terms
If paying for solar panels in cash is out of reach, solar loans are an affordable option because they cut back your upfront costs and allow you to pay for your system over five to seven years on average. However, the interest on solar loans also adds to your total costs, so it's important to keep that in mind as well. You can always lower the total you pay in interest and in some cases even your APR by putting more money down.
Solar Panel Installation Company
Lastly, the company you get to install your solar panel system can impact how much it costs. Reliez Valley's solar companies all have different labor costs and add varying upcharges to equipment. Larger national companies usually have lower costs, but some local companies compete with them by promoting sales and discounts. While the smaller companies might not have access to specific equipment options like Tesla Powerwall batteries or additional services like electric vehicle charger installation, they might be cheaper overall.

How to Save on Solar Panels
The company that does your solar system installation will affect the warranties and brands you have access to, and it will also have an impact on your total cost. Since picking a company can be difficult, we have some tips to help you, such as:
- Installation Process: An important thing to understand when going solar is the installation process itself. Be sure to align on any details you should know with your solar installer, such as what permits you should acquire and what the project timeline is.
- Solar Panel Brands: Different companies will carry various brands and models of panels. If you know you want a specific brand, make sure the solar panel company you're considering has it.
- Contract: When looking through your solar company's contract, ask questions about any terms you're not sure of and make sure you understand what happens in scenarios such as a system component breaking or the company going out of business.
- Reputation: Companies that have been operating for many years likely have a solid reputation. This is important because it ensures that it will not only see your solar installation through, but will also provide adequate aftercare and customer support, such as part repairs and replacements.

Are solar panels free in Reliez Valley?
Solar panels aren't free in Reliez Valley, but there are some options that can make getting them more feasible, such as leasing solar panels or getting a solar loan. There may also be local programs or incentives that you can take advantage of.
How much can I save on power bills after switching to solar?
Solar panels can potentially eliminate your electricity bills depending on where you're located and the efficiency of your system. Even if it doesn't get rid of them completely, you can save a lot of money on your bills, about $1,729.84 per year.
What solar power system size is right for my home?
The exact number of solar panels you need depends on your household energy usage and how much sunlight your roof gets. You can look at your energy bills for the past year to get an idea of the solar system size you'll need. The average household has to install between 20 and 35 panels to cover their typical energy usage.
